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Station Landing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Station Landing with 3 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Station Landing is at 11 Langdon St listed at $3,200.

How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Station Landing Apartment?

The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Station Landing is $3,800.

What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Station Landing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Station Landing is a 1,517 square feet unit starting from $4,638 at Modera Medford.

What is the average size for Station Landing 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Station Landing is currently 1,217 sq ft.
